Docker and Prompt Engineering frequently appear together in AI job postings, with 37 current openings requiring both skills. The most common role for this combination is AI/ML Engineer. Jobs requiring both skills pay up to $174K on average. Below you'll find detailed salary data, hiring companies, and related skill combinations.
Deploying LLM applications in production requires both Prompt Engineering expertise and Docker infrastructure skills. Docker provides the compute, scaling, and serving layer, while Prompt Engineering handles the AI application logic. The 37 roles listing both reflect the growing need for engineers who can bridge AI development and cloud operations.

Career Impact
Professionals who combine Docker and Prompt Engineering earn a median salary ceiling of
$174K, compared to $215K for Docker alone and
$210K for Prompt Engineering alone. This 18% discount
reflects roles requiring both skills tend to be more common mid-level positions, while single-skill roles may skew toward senior or specialized positions with higher pay ceilings.
